import static org.mockito.Mockito.verify;
import static org.opendaylight.controller.cluster.databroker.actors.dds.TestUtils.TRANSACTION_ID;
import static org.opendaylight.controller.cluster.databroker.actors.dds.TestUtils.getWithTimeout;
import com.google.common.util.concurrent.ListenableFuture;
import static org.mockito.Mockito.verify;
import static org.opendaylight.controller.cluster.databroker.actors.dds.TestUtils.TRANSACTION_ID;
import static org.opendaylight.controller.cluster.databroker.actors.dds.TestUtils.getWithTimeout;
import com.google.common.util.concurrent.ListenableFuture;
cohort = new EmptyTransactionCommitCohort(history, TRANSACTION_ID);
}
@Test
public void testCanCommit() throws Exception {
final ListenableFuture<Boolean> canCommit = cohort.canCommit();
cohort = new EmptyTransactionCommitCohort(history, TRANSACTION_ID);
}
@Test
public void testCanCommit() throws Exception {
final ListenableFuture<Boolean> canCommit = cohort.canCommit();
}
@Test
public void testPreCommit() throws Exception {
final ListenableFuture<Void> preCommit = cohort.preCommit();
}
@Test
public void testPreCommit() throws Exception {
final ListenableFuture<Void> preCommit = cohort.preCommit();
}
@Test
public void testAbort() throws Exception {
final ListenableFuture<Void> abort = cohort.abort();
verify(history).onTransactionComplete(TRANSACTION_ID);
}
@Test
public void testAbort() throws Exception {
final ListenableFuture<Void> abort = cohort.abort();
verify(history).onTransactionComplete(TRANSACTION_ID);
}
@Test
public void testCommit() throws Exception {
final ListenableFuture<Void> commit = cohort.commit();
verify(history).onTransactionComplete(TRANSACTION_ID);
}
@Test
public void testCommit() throws Exception {
final ListenableFuture<Void> commit = cohort.commit();
verify(history).onTransactionComplete(TRANSACTION_ID);